Your workplace

The Rehabilitation Unit at Torsby Hospital is a joint operation consisting of occupational therapy, physiotherapy, and social work consultations as well as day rehabilitation. A speech therapist and assistive technology specialist are present 1-2 days a week. The unit has its own budget and personnel responsibility and operates in both inpatient and outpatient care.

We have a friendly and diverse team of occupational therapists, physiotherapists, nursing assistants/rehabilitation assistants, social workers, and medical secretaries who support and help each other in daily work. We are 25 employees with great commitment working to provide the best possible care and service to our patients and partners. We work closely with all departments and clinics at the hospital as well as management and the leadership team.

Your tasks

As a physiotherapist, you will work together with the patient to achieve or maintain the best possible functional ability and independence. You will examine, assess, treat, train, teach, and provide advice to the patient based on their specific needs and goals to achieve the best possible results. The work is mainly done individually with patients but also in groups. Home visits may also occur. Guidance of staff and students, as well as collaboration with relatives, occurs regularly in the work.

With us, you may work as a physiotherapist in both inpatient and outpatient care.

Your skills and competencies

We are looking for someone with a Swedish license as a physiotherapist. We also welcome applications from those who are in the final stages of their physiotherapy education. You have good knowledge of the Swedish language in both speech and writing. Experience as a physiotherapist is meritorious but not a requirement. A B driver's license is desirable.
